Moroccan Man Arrested for Fatal Stabbing of Father in Inheritance Dispute

A young man coldly murdered his father on Friday using a bladed weapon in Khenifra.
Confined to their homes, the inhabitants of the Mzizt douar in the commune of Lakbaba in the province of Khénifra were shaken this May 1st by a parricide of which an 85-year-old man was the victim.
According to Barlamane, his son would have stabbed him several times, leaving him lifeless and lying in his blood, before fleeing. The accused would have committed this despicable crime because of an inheritance.
Alerted, the gendarmes arrived on the scene. The body of the deceased was transferred to the morgue for an autopsy.
An investigation has been opened under the supervision of the competent prosecutor’s office to determine the ins and outs of this case.
